#CPD data show #Chicago in May had 36 #murders. If the figure holds, it’ll be two fewer than May 2025 (38) and the lowest May total since 2007 (34). Year to date, murders are up slightly (5.7%) from 2025. That year ended with the city’s lowest murder count in six decades.

CONTEXT: The money is stunning compared to 2022, the last time Chicago-area Dems vied in U.S. House primaries with no incumbent. In that election cycle, Jonathan Jackson benefited from $1.1 million in super PAC support. Delia Ramirez got a $1.5 million boost. Both won.
